N2 + 3H2 + 2NH3
What type of reaction is this

Answer:It is a combination reaction; nitrogen and hydrogen combine to form ammonia

Explanation:

This is the reaction that is used to make ammonia from hydrogen and nitrogen. In this reaction, only one product is formed. Therefore, this reaction is known as a combination reaction.
